The Dead Daisies embody the spirit of rock resilience and cultural fusion, showcasing the genre's ability to evolve and adapt. Their music reflects a blend of influences, illustrating how diverse backgrounds can unite to create powerful art. This band serves as a reminder of rock's enduring legacy and its capacity to resonate across different cultures and generations.
